Modern Vaccination Programmes in Rural & Remote Areas

Abstract:

Access to healthcare, especially vaccination programmes, plays a pivotal role in ensuring public health and preventing the spread of infectious diseases. However, rural and remote areas often face unique challenges that can hinder the effective implementation of vaccination initiatives. This comprehensive essay explores the modern vaccination programmes designed to address these challenges, examining the strategies, technologies, and community engagement models that contribute to successful vaccination campaigns in rural and remote regions.

1. Introduction:

1.1 Background Rural and remote areas are characterized by geographical isolation, limited infrastructure, and sparse populations. These factors pose significant challenges to healthcare delivery, making the implementation of vaccination programmes particularly complex.

1.2 Importance of Vaccination

Vaccination is a cornerstone of public health, preventing the spread of infectious diseases and reducing morbidity and mortality. Ensuring equitable access to vaccines is crucial for achieving global health goals.

2. Challenges in Rural and Remote Areas:

2.1 Geographical Barriers

The vast distances and difficult terrain in rural and remote areas can impede the timely delivery of vaccines. Addressing these geographical challenges requires innovative transportation and distribution strategies.

2.2 Limited Infrastructure

The lack of healthcare facilities, cold chain storage, and reliable electricity in remote areas poses a threat to the efficacy of vaccines. Modern vaccination programmes must account for these limitations and implement solutions to overcome infrastructure gaps.

2.3 Socioeconomic Factors

Economic constraints, low literacy rates, and cultural beliefs can contribute to vaccine hesitancy and impact the overall success of vaccination campaigns. Community engagement and education are crucial components in addressing these challenges.

3. Strategies for Modern Vaccination Programmes:

3.1 Technological Innovations

Utilizing technology, such as drones and mobile clinics, can overcome geographical barriers and enhance vaccine delivery in remote areas. Additionally, incorporating digital tools for record-keeping and monitoring vaccine coverage improves efficiency.

3.2 Cold Chain Management

Innovative cold chain solutions, like solar-powered refrigeration and temperature monitoring devices, ensure the integrity of vaccines in areas with limited access to electricity and refrigeration.

3.3 Community Engagement

Developing culturally sensitive and community-specific vaccination campaigns fosters trust and addresses vaccine hesitancy. Involving local leaders, leveraging community networks, and providing education on the benefits of vaccination are essential components of successful programmes.

4. Case Studies: Successful Implementation of Modern Vaccination Programmes:

4.1 Rwanda’s Immunization

Program Rwanda has successfully implemented a comprehensive immunization program, utilizing community health workers and leveraging technology to reach remote areas. This case study highlights the importance of a multifaceted approach to overcome barriers.

4.2 India’s Pulse Polio Campaign

India’s Pulse Polio Campaign demonstrates the effectiveness of large-scale, community-based vaccination efforts. The campaign’s success in reaching remote and underserved populations provides valuable insights for similar initiatives globally.
